Key Responsibilities:
The primary duties and responsibilities include but are not limited to:

1. Answering incoming calls, assessing the needs of callers, and directing them to the appropriate personnel.
2. Scheduling appointments for new patients, referrals, and returning patients in accordance with office protocols.
3. Maintaining accurate patient records and documentation within the electronic medical records (EMR) system.
4. Collecting co-pays and other payments at the time of service.
5. Managing the scheduling template to ensure efficient office operations.
6. Coordinating financial counseling for patients as necessary.
7. Upholding patient confidentiality and adhering to clinic policies and procedures.
8. Preparing correspondence and documentation as requested by supervisors.
9. Scheduling outpatient appointments, tests, and surgeries as needed, ensuring all necessary pre-certifications are obtained.
10. Following up on pre-operative tests to ensure patients are cleared for surgical procedures and scheduling post-operative follow-ups.

Qualifications:
The ideal candidate for the Appointment Coordinator position will possess the following qualifications:

- Level 1: High school diploma or equivalent required; entry-level position with 0-3 years of experience, preferably in a medical office.
- Level 2: Minimum of three years of office experience, ideally in a medical setting.
- Senior Level: Minimum of five years of office experience, with a strong understanding of medical terminology and coding.
- Excellent communication skills, both written and verbal, are essential.
- Proficiency in Microsoft Office applications (Outlook, Word, Excel) is required.
